How they compare
Belgium currently reports 9.91 units per square kilometre against 9.43 units per square kilometre in Curaçao, a difference of 0.48 units per square kilometre.
That makes Belgium's figure about 1.1 times Curaçao's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 13 shared years of data; in 2011 it was Belgium ahead.
Belgium ranks 20th and Curaçao ranks 21st of 215 countries.
Belgium has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
